This is a recipe that I remember making for gifts when I was a kid. It is so easy, fun and cheap but looks really impressive and tastes luxurious. They are perfect for a last minute mother’s day gift and cost less than £1.50.
Ingredients
100g chocolate
100ml double cream
18g butter
Toppings: icing sugar, crushed nuts, grated chocolate, cocoa
Method
Melt the chocolate in a bowl over a pan of water.
Bring the cream and butter just to the boil and whisk into chocolate.
Leave the mixture in the fridge for one to two hours.
Form into small balls and roll in toppings. Put back in the fridge to firm.
Tips:
- The longer you leave the mixture the easier it is to work with
- Don’t worry about making perfect rounds, the toppings will cover it
